Preparation

Fresh quinces are not consumed because of their astringent (caused by high tannin content). Quinces are used as jams and jellies, as they contain large amounts of pectin. The fruit can be consumed in the form of stewed or baked. Quinces remain well for approximately a week whenever kept open in cool, darkish spot faraway from heat, and also moisture. They store for many weeks positioned in the fridge.
